An object is projected with a velocity of 100 ms\(^{-1}\) from the ground level at an angle \(\theta\) to the vertical. If the total time of flight of the projectile is 10 s, calculate θ. (g = 10 ms\(^{-2}\)).
0o
30o
45o
60o
90o
Explanation
T = \(\frac{2u sin θ}{g}\)
sin θ = \(\frac{Tg}{2u}\)
sin θ = \(\frac{10 \times 10}{2 \times 100}\) = 0.5
θ = sin\(^{- 0.5}\) = 30º
\(\theta\)\(_{horizontal}\) = 30º
But \(\theta\)\(_{vertical}\) = 90º - 30º = 60º
